TEC BAR: New highlight in the product portfolio thanks to technological breakthrough

A new highlight in the product portfolio of CG TEC, the technology leader based in Spalt near Nuremberg, is the TEC BAR: an innovative reinforcing bar made of high-performance fibers for use in concrete.

The development of the TEC BAR required innovative solutions for optimal force transmission between fibers and concrete. As the TEC BAR cannot be bent like steel, CG TEC has developed special joining techniques that enable flexible applications, while comprehensive testing procedures guarantee long-term stability under a wide range of environmental conditions.

The technical properties are impressive: at only a quarter of the weight of steel, TEC BAR offers extremely high tensile strength. The corrosion resistance to chemicals, salt water and alkaline environments enables a significantly longer service life for the structures – over 100 years is realistic.

A decisive advantage also lies in sustainability: by eliminating the minimum cover required for steel reinforcement, up to 80% of concrete can be saved. This leads to slimmer constructions and a significantly improved carbon footprint. In addition, the TEC BAR made of glass and basalt fibers is electrically non-conductive, which makes it ideal for applications where stray current corrosion must be avoided.

Regulatory breakthrough paves the way for many applications

With the introduction of the first generally applicable guideline for non-metallic reinforcement by the German Committee for Reinforced Concrete (DAfStb) in January 2024, this technology has officially found its way into construction practice. This removes bureaucratic hurdles and establishes binding standards for planning and execution.

The TEC BAR is ideal for:

  • New construction of thin-walled concrete components (bridges, parking garages)
  • Precast concrete parts with high corrosion resistance requirements
  • Buildings in aggressive environments (port buildings, chemical plants)
  • Applications requiring electrical insulation
  • Repair and reinforcement of existing reinforced concrete structures

Tried and tested success story at Köhler Beton

With Klaus Köhler Beton- und Fertigteilwerk GmbH, CG TEC has gained another important customer for the large-volume use of the TEC BAR. Köhler Beton is already successfully using TEC BAR in the production of cable duct covers for concrete cable ducts for Deutsche Bahn AG. Extensive tests and developments were carried out to ensure the durability and performance of the TEC BAR for this specific application. The additional advantages in terms of handling and carbon footprint have proven to be significant in practice.
